Output 3db12293c8042f8fc080b62f1fce76a8e8ee68c8c80a52652718b11baddfeb42:1

value
1343403
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 276ceeb265e4b5e1051d4d71ca51cedf58801875 OP_EQUALVERIFY OP_CHECKSIG
address
14bTrEoHbrwHKLLcriSW1ogkoWSnUhmHYi
transaction
3db12293c8042f8fc080b62f1fce76a8e8ee68c8c80a52652718b11baddfeb42
spent
true